How to Cite a Press Release in APA Format

Citing a press release in APA format requires the organization name, date, press release title, and URL. Press releases are official statements issued by organizations, companies, or government agencies.

Basic Press Release Citation Format

The standard APA 7th edition format for a press release citation is:

Reference list entry:

Organization Name. (Year, Month Day). Title of press release [Press release]. https://www.example.com/press-release

Parenthetical in-text citation: (Organization Name, Year)

Narrative in-text citation: Organization Name (Year)

In-Text Citation Examples

When you reference a press release within your paper, you have two options:

  • Parenthetical: The company announced a merger with its largest competitor (Apple Inc., 2024).
  • Narrative: Apple Inc. (2024) announced a merger with its largest competitor.

Common Variations

Corporate Press Release

Microsoft. (2024, January 18). Microsoft announces expansion of AI research division [Press release]. https://news.microsoft.com/2024/01/18/ai-expansion

Government Press Release

U.S. Department of Justice. (2023, November 5). Department of Justice files antitrust lawsuit [Press release]. https://www.justice.gov/opa/pr/example

Press Release from a News Wire Service

If the press release was distributed through a wire service (e.g., PR Newswire, Business Wire), list the originating organization as the author and include the wire service URL.

Johnson & Johnson. (2024, February 20). New clinical trial results show promising outcomes [Press release]. PR Newswire. https://www.prnewswire.com/news-releases/example

Tips for Citing Press Releases

  • Use [Press release] in square brackets after the title to identify the source type.
  • Use the organization as the author, not the person who wrote or signed the press release.
  • Include the full date (year, month, and day) of the press release.
  • Provide the direct URL to the press release, not the organization’s homepage.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are press releases considered reliable academic sources? Press releases are primary sources that represent an organization’s official position. They are useful for documenting announcements and corporate actions but may contain bias.

How do I cite a press release if no date is listed? Use (n.d.) in place of the date if no publication date is available.

Can I cite a press release found in a news article? If you accessed the content through a news article rather than the original press release, cite the news article instead.
